General Information:

- 22 minutes from Boone, NC and 17 minutes from Wilkesboro on a quiet rural road
- The is an upscale camping/glamping, off grid experience which is 30 minutes from Appalachian Ski Resort
- Private port-a-toilet bathroom cleaned before each guest
- There is no running water. We supply you with two bottles of water and you would bring additional water (half gallon to one gallon per day)
- We supply a camping shower, good for two short showers in warm weather only
- We also have sanitary wipes to freshen up year around
- Lighting: solar powered system for indoor and outdoor lighting & phone charging
- Solar power with generator backup supplies electricity for microwave, Keurig & ceiling fan
- Outdoor gas grill for cooking.
- We supply a large cooler for your food, you bring the ice
- For air circulation, you have six screen windows and a screened front porch door, ceiling fan
- Easy access to Tiny Home, 70 feet from parking lot, hauling cart provided
- We supply most everything you need and a list of items you need to bring.
